Trump Says's He'll Declare National Emergency to Build Wall If No Deal Is Made With Democrats

Della Sun
President Trump said this morning that if he doesn’t reach an agreement with the Democrats, he is considering getting the funds by declaring a national emergency. Soundbite:PO-24TH “I have the absolute right to declare a national emergency. I haven't done it yet. I may do it. If this doesn't work out probably I will do it. I would almost say definitely.” :PO-36TH “Either we're going to win or make a compromise. I'm okay to making a compromise. Compromise is in my vocabulary very strongly. So we're either going to have a win, make a compromise -- because I think a compromise is a win for everybody." Trump also said that he may not be going to Switzerland for the World Economic Forum later this month if the government remains partially closed. And later this afternoon he announced in a tweet that he had decided not to attend. Soundbite:PO-65TH if the shutdown continues, I won't go. I had planned to go. It's been very successful when I went. We have a great story to tell. We have the best job numbers we've ever had in many ways. Certainly with African-Americans, with Hispanics, with Asian-Americans. And overall we have the best job numbers in at least 50 years. We have a lot of great things happening. The economy is incredible, we're negotiating and having tremendous success with China”
